For the seventh time in eight years, the American Silver Eagle coins set a sales record in 2014. The US Mint recorded total sales of 44,006,000 coins. This mark remains the second-highest in program history behind only the 2015 Silver Eagles and represented a modest increase over the previous year. Coins in Mint State 69 condition exhibit full, original mint luster with no more than two minor detracting flaws present. Examples of acceptable flaws at this grade level include minuscule contact marks or hairlines only.
The growth in demand for the Silver Eagles in 2014 was relatively modest by recent standards in the 2010s. The mintage figure increased by roughly 1.4 million coins to a new record high. Opening day sales in 2014 accounted for 3,180,500 coins in total and the US Mint had to institute periodic suspensions in production and rationing at the point of purchase in order to meet demand.
On the obverse of 2014 1 oz American Silver Eagle Coins is Walking Liberty. This iconic design first featured on the Walking Liberty Half Dollar coin from 1916 to 1947. The design is representative of America’s drive toward a brighter future, with Liberty walking toward the setting sun on the horizon. Her left hand is outstretched toward the horizon as she wears the American flag over her shoulders.
The reverse face of 2014 American Silver Eagles bears the oldest American coin design element. The heraldic eagle of the United States featured on the first coins ever issued by the US Mint in 1794. This is a modern depiction of that iconic design and was modified in 1986 by John Mercanti for use on the Silver Eagles.
